As a Scrum Master, you’ll be a part of a highly collaborative, cross-functional Scrum team. You’ll advise and lead the squads on Agile values, practices and processes to ensure that the squad is fully functional, productive, and focused on the sprint goal. The Expertise We’re Looking For Strong understanding of and experience with Agile practices, processes, and artifacts Practical and related experiences in leading squads Certified Scrum Master (CSM), at minimum The Purpose of Your Role As a Scrum Master, you will work directly in a squad or team to advise and oversee performance against agile values, practices and processes. Working with the squad leader (or product owner), you will support the work of the squad by maintaining the backlog and facilitating agile ceremonies like stand ups, sprint planning and retrospectives. You will monitor team performance through the squad’s dashboard and help identify continuous improvement opportunities to help the team work better and smarter. The Skills You Bring Your ability to influence behavior without having organizational hierarchy Your strong change management skills Your ability to brainstorm with the team on solutions to address challenges and roadblocks Your excellent communication and people-interaction skills Your organized and disciplined nature Your continuous improvement mindset Your ability to calculate team's velocity and other metrics The Value You Deliver Encouraging Agile behaviors, reinforcing practices, norms, ceremonies, and supporting the overall Squad performance and effectiveness Identifying team improvement opportunities and looking externally for best practices to support continuous improvement Managing and coordinating logistics for Agile ceremonies and practices, e.g., backlog maintenance, sprint planning, daily stand-ups, and retrospectives Calculating team’s velocity and other metrics Ensuring all work is tracked in the backlog and properly balanced across team members Maintaining and updating the Squad's process metrics and artifacts to ensure accurate and transparent communications to stakeholders Driving a collaborative and supportive team culture through team building and engagement practices How Your Work Impacts the Organization Everyone craves a way of working that empowers them to unleash their best work and inspire better futures for more people.
